Can I run multiple "charts" in one window?

 

I've been searching for a solution for a couple of days now, but still not 100% sure if at all this is possible... what I want is broken up in 2 pieces:


1. Say I want EURUSD "chart" -> this will open without showing a chart, but only info - i.e. window that spans across the screen, but is only x pixels high. I want text (info) to appear instead of chart. i.e. High, low, open, close, current, volume and perhaps an Indicator value or 2 - no chart!! This info is updated each time EURUSD receive a tick

2. Have 1 window that have multiple of windows as explained in number 1 under each other (i.e. the above should be "sub-windows in this window)... then have option to add more of window 1 type or remove a window of the above type from this window.

Therefore it is a window that looks "almost" like the Market Watch section, but with custom information... I might also later want an option of clicking/right-clicking on a "window1" and then have option to go to chart window for that window (but that is a problem for later).


SUMMERY

Please let me know what is the best way to do this in!!... i.e:

1. can you create an empty window that is not hooked up to a currency?

2. Can you add multiple windows (like Indicators appear in their own window) to this blank window, but each "indicator" is hooked up to a currency pair.

Not quite. The main difference is:

- I want to view multiple currency (EURUSD, GBPUSD etc) pairs in one go.

- Timeframe does not matter as long as all price ticks come through for every pair. Therefore I was looking at a solution that creates 1 main chart window (without chart showing). Inside this Main chart window, there are multiple other chart windows (none show charts), only details as mentioned above. i.e. I do not want to clutter the tabs at the bottom and confuse them with "real Chart windows"... idealy all above should be contained in 1 tab item.

- I do not want to see the chart at all. Just things like High, Low, Open, Close, Volume etc together with some custom indicator levels. Similar to "Market Watch" just with more detail

 
any solutions to this?
 
DaClan: - I do not want to see the chart at all.
Can't be done. You have to have a chart. Put whatever you want in the subwindow and squeeze the chart small.
